ConfigParser considers leading white space before options and comments to be syntax errors, which is a bit harsh, and limits the utility of the module when parsing files originally written for other programs, such as Samba's smb.conf. The attached patch ignores leading white space on options, and skips comments with leading w.s. |

I tried to come up with a patch, but the issue isn't as easy as it seems, the proposed change is too simplistic. Leading spaces in a line is already used for one purpose : continuations of a previous line. For instance : option = value continued here gives "option" as key and "value\n continued here" as value. The proposal conflicts with this behavior, since having : option1 = value1 option2 = value2 creates only one key-value pair "option1":"value1\n option2=value2" Adding blank lines doesn't solve the issue. The only case when it's treated correctly is when the options is the first one of a section/file: there's no continuation since there's no previous option defined. One solution could be to check for the presence of a delimiter (colon or equals sign) and not treat it as a continuation if that's the case, but that could potentially break existing configurations files, since nothing forbids you from using delimiters in the values. Any opinion ? (By the way, the leading whitespaces for comments isn't affected by all this, the implementation is simple) |
